A course I'll be working with has various online and file resources which will need to go into some kind of repository. As there'll be hundreds of these there'll need to be decent metadata (at least DC, plus custom elements for local use), not least because the thing will need to interoperate with other course repositories.

Metadata doesn't get a mention, as far as I can see. The impression I get is that the native Moodle repository is simply a file store, though you can 'plug in' external repositories. If the native filestore can't handle detailed metadata, then I could write a bespoke repository and try to develop a Moodle plugin for it - is there any documentation on doing this?
